Multi-Purpose Oscillograph Market Restraint
Despite the growing demand for multi-purpose oscillographs, there are several factors that could limit market growth. One significant restraint is the high cost of advanced oscillograph models. While high-end oscillographs with enhanced features and capabilities offer superior performance, they come with a high price tag. This can be a barrier for small to medium-sized enterprises, particularly in emerging markets where budgets for such advanced tools may be limited. Additionally, the complexity of these instruments may require specialized training for operators, which can increase costs and time investments for companies looking to adopt new technologies. While the market for multi-purpose oscillographs is expanding, these factors may hinder the broader adoption of these instruments in certain regions and industries.
Another restraint is the competition from alternative testing tools that can offer similar functionalities at a lower cost. For example, some industries may opt for digital multimeters, spectrum analyzers, or logic analyzers, which can perform basic measurements and analysis tasks without the need for a dedicated oscillograph. These alternatives may be more affordable and easier to use, which could limit the growth of the multi-purpose oscillograph market in certain segments. Furthermore, the increasing availability of open-source software and affordable DIY test equipment may also act as a restraint, particularly for smaller businesses or educational institutions that seek low-cost solutions for signal measurement and analysis. Despite these challenges, multi-purpose oscillographs remain a critical tool for precise diagnostics in various industries.
